2010 Toyota RAV4 fuel consumption
2 versions rated. Official figures from the Australian Government’s Green Vehicle Guide.
Fuel use, combined
8.4–9.1 L/100km
lower is better
Cost to run a year
$2,176–$2,357
at 14,000km
CO₂ from the exhaust
197–214 g/km
per kilometre
About average for a 2010 car, which used 8.3 L/100km.
Every 2010 Toyota RAV4 version
| Version | Engine | Fuel use | City | Highway | Cost/year | CO₂ |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2WD Wagon Manual | 2.4L 4cyl Petrol 91RON | 8.4 | 10.7 | 7.0 | $2,176 | 197 Slightly worse than average |
| 2WD Wagon Auto | 2.4L 4cyl Petrol 91RON | 9.1 | 11.9 | 7.4 | $2,357 | 214 Slightly worse than average |

Figures come from a standardised laboratory test, so every car is measured the same way. Your own fuel use will differ with traffic, load, tyre pressure and how you drive. Running costs assume 14,000km a year at recent average fuel prices.
